Baansera Park, or Bansera Park, is a beautiful bamboo-themed park located in Delhi, which has been created by the Delhi Development Authority. This park is situated in the vicinity of Sarai Kale Khan and provides its visitors with an atmosphere of tranquility through bamboo plantations and landscaped areas.

Baansera Park Timings
Baansera Park is usually visited during morning and evening time when the weather is pleasant. The visitors are requested to refer to the latest schedule of the DDA as timing varies with seasons and maintenance work.
| Day | Opening Time | Closing Time |
| Monday | 5:00 AM | 10:00 PM |
| Tuesday | 5:00 AM | 10:00 PM |
| Wednesday | 5:00 AM | 10:00 PM |
| Thursday | 5:00 AM | 10:00 PM |
| Friday | 5:00 AM | 10:00 PM |
| Saturday | 5:00 AM | 10:00 PM |
| Sunday | 5:00 AM | 10:00 PM |

Nearest Metro Station to Baansera Park
Nearest metro connectivity exists at the Sarai Kale Khan-Nizamuddin vicinity. Travellers can make use of the metro station close to the venue and complete the journey on foot, auto-rickshaw or cab.
| Metro Station | Distance | Transport Options |
| Sarai Kale Khan–Nizamuddin | Nearby | Auto, E-rickshaw, Cab |
| Jangpura | Around 3–4 km | Auto, Cab |
| Ashram Marg | Around 3–4 km | Auto, Cab |
Nearest Railway Station to Baansera Park
The Hazrat Nizamuddin Railway Station is considered to be the most convenient station for visitors who have to go to Baansera Park via train. It is situated near the Sarai Kale Khan region.
| Railway Station | Approximate Distance | Best Transport |
| Hazrat Nizamuddin Railway Station | Around 1–2 km | Auto, Cab |
| New Delhi Railway Station | Around 8–10 km | Metro, Cab |
| Anand Vihar Terminal | Around 9–11 km | Metro, Cab |
